+static IR_KEYTAB_TYPE avacssmart_codes[IR_KEYTAB_SIZE] = {
+ [ 30 ] = KEY_POWER, // power
+ [ 28 ] = KEY_SEARCH, // scan
+ [ 7 ] = KEY_SELECT, // source
+
+ [ 22 ] = KEY_VOLUMEUP,
+ [ 20 ] = KEY_VOLUMEDOWN,
+ [ 31 ] = KEY_CHANNELUP,
+ [ 23 ] = KEY_CHANNELDOWN,
+ [ 24 ] = KEY_MUTE,
+
+ [ 2 ] = KEY_KP0,
+ [ 1 ] = KEY_KP1,
+ [ 11 ] = KEY_KP2,
+ [ 27 ] = KEY_KP3,
+ [ 5 ] = KEY_KP4,
+ [ 9 ] = KEY_KP5,
+ [ 21 ] = KEY_KP6,
+ [ 6 ] = KEY_KP7,
+ [ 10 ] = KEY_KP8,
+ [ 18 ] = KEY_KP9,
+ [ 16 ] = KEY_KPDOT,
+
+ [ 3 ] = KEY_TUNER, // tv/fm
+ [ 4 ] = KEY_REWIND, // fm tuning left or function left
+ [ 12 ] = KEY_FORWARD, // fm tuning right or function right
+
+ [ 0 ] = KEY_RECORD,
+ [ 8 ] = KEY_STOP,
+ [ 17 ] = KEY_PLAY,
+
+ [ 25 ] = KEY_ZOOM,
+ [ 14 ] = KEY_MENU, // function
+ [ 19 ] = KEY_AGAIN, // recall
+ [ 29 ] = KEY_RESTART, // reset
+
+// FIXME
+ [ 13 ] = KEY_F21, // mts
+ [ 15 ] = KEY_F22, // min
+ [ 26 ] = KEY_F23, // freeze
+};
+
+/* Alex Hermann <gaaf@gmx.net> */
+static IR_KEYTAB_TYPE md2819_codes[IR_KEYTAB_SIZE] = {
+ [ 40 ] = KEY_KP1,
+ [ 24 ] = KEY_KP2,
+ [ 56 ] = KEY_KP3,
+ [ 36 ] = KEY_KP4,
+ [ 20 ] = KEY_KP5,
+ [ 52 ] = KEY_KP6,
+ [ 44 ] = KEY_KP7,
+ [ 28 ] = KEY_KP8,
+ [ 60 ] = KEY_KP9,
+ [ 34 ] = KEY_KP0,
+
+ [ 32 ] = KEY_TV, // TV/FM
+ [ 16 ] = KEY_CD, // CD
+ [ 48 ] = KEY_TEXT, // TELETEXT
+ [ 0 ] = KEY_POWER, // POWER
+
+ [ 8 ] = KEY_VIDEO, // VIDEO
+ [ 4 ] = KEY_AUDIO, // AUDIO
+ [ 12 ] = KEY_ZOOM, // FULL SCREEN
+
+ [ 18 ] = KEY_SUBTITLE, // DISPLAY - ???
+ [ 50 ] = KEY_REWIND, // LOOP - ???
+ [ 2 ] = KEY_PRINT, // PREVIEW - ???
+
+ [ 42 ] = KEY_SEARCH, // AUTOSCAN
+ [ 26 ] = KEY_SLEEP, // FREEZE - ???
+ [ 58 ] = KEY_SHUFFLE, // SNAPSHOT - ???
+ [ 10 ] = KEY_MUTE, // MUTE
+
+ [ 38 ] = KEY_RECORD, // RECORD
+ [ 22 ] = KEY_PAUSE, // PAUSE
+ [ 54 ] = KEY_STOP, // STOP
+ [ 6 ] = KEY_PLAY, // PLAY
+
+ [ 46 ] = KEY_RED, // <RED>
+ [ 33 ] = KEY_GREEN, // <GREEN>
+ [ 14 ] = KEY_YELLOW, // <YELLOW>
+ [ 1 ] = KEY_BLUE, // <BLUE>
+
+ [ 30 ] = KEY_VOLUMEDOWN, // VOLUME-
+ [ 62 ] = KEY_VOLUMEUP, // VOLUME+
+ [ 17 ] = KEY_CHANNELDOWN, // CHANNEL/PAGE-
+ [ 49 ] = KEY_CHANNELUP // CHANNEL/PAGE+
+};